For the optimal readability and accessibility, you should go with140 – 180% line height (this is the space around a line of text). This means if your font size is 16pt, your line height should be at least 16 x 1.4 = 22.4pt (140%), or 16 x1.8= 28.8pt ... WebAccording to most style guides, nouns, pronouns, verbs, adjectives, and adverbs are capitalized in titles of books, articles, and songs. You’d also capitalize the first word and (according to most guides) the last word of a title, regardless of what part of speech they are. A few parts of speech tend to be lowercase.
Web12 Feb 2010 · The first word of the title and of the subtitle The last word of the title ALL OTHER WORDS except conjunctions ( and, or, but, nor, yet, so, for ), articles ( a, an, the ), and short prepositions ( in, to, of, at, by, up, for, off, on ).
